Когда GitBash запускается, как обнаружить и перехватить событие, когда загружен файл .gitconfig и установлены глобальные учетные данные git - PullRequest
0 голосов
/ 10 января 2019

Мне нужно запустить предопределенную функцию (содержащую команды git) сразу после запуска GitBash и загрузки файла .gitconfig и установки его глобальных значений конфигурации, чтобы во время выполнения этой предопределенной пользовательской функции Git Ошибки аутентификации не встречаются.

Как мне этого добиться? Не очень знаком с событиями Bash и последовательностью загрузки ..

Git для Windows версии 2.20.1 - Windows 7 x64.

1 Ответ

0 голосов
/ 10 января 2019

Насколько мне известно, .gitconfig не загружается при запуске bash (он загружается каждый раз при запуске git-процесса, конечно, но не bash). Если вы хотите определить собственные команды и вещи, которые будут доступны на bash, лучшее место для этого - использовать ~/.bash_profile для их определения. Git для Windows: .bashrc или эквивалентные файлы конфигурации для оболочки Git Bash

...